Net Price by Family Income

Average net price for students receiving Title IV federal financial aid (2022-23)

$0 - $30,000

$21,950

$30,001 - $48,000

$20,840

$48,001 - $75,000

$21,448

$75,001 - $110,000

$24,280

Over $110,000

$26,869

Financial Aid Overview

For first-time, full-time undergraduate students (2022-23)

Students Receiving Any Financial Aid

168 of 169 students

99%

Grants & Scholarships

Recipients

168 (99%)

Average Award

$22,903

Federal Pell Grants

Recipients

92 (54%)

Average Award

$5,107

Aid by Source

State & Local Grants

74 recipients (44%)

$6,740 avg

Institutional Grants

168 recipients (99%)

$16,953 avg
